TAMPA, Fla. (WFLA) — The historic Powerball jackpot was finally claimed Saturday night, with two lucky winners in Missouri and Texas.

The final total was $1.787 billion, the second largest in history, following a $2.04 billion jackpot won by a California player in 2022. The winning numbers in Saturday night's draw were 11, 23, 44, 61, 62 and Powerball 17.

The two winners will split the prize evenly and have the option of either an annuitized prize of $893.50 or a lump sum payment of $ 410.30 million.

Even though only two people claimed the top prize, many more won cash prizes. Powerball said more than 9.9 million tickets won something Saturday night.
